Position Title: Off Net Solutions (ONS) Dark Fiber Contracts Intern


 


Company Summary 


Crown Castle is the nation’s largest provider of shared communications infrastructure: towers, small cells and fiber. It all works together to meet unprecedented demand—connecting people and communities and transforming the way we do business. Whenever you make a call, track a workout or stream music and videos, we’re the ones providing the communications infrastructure that makes it all possible. From 5G and the internet of things to drones, autonomous vehicles and AR/VR, we enable the technologies that help people stay safe, connected and ready for the future. Crown Castle is a Fortune 500 company, publicly traded on the S&P 500, and one of the largest Real Estate Investment Trusts in the US, with an enterprise value of ~$100B.


 


Role


This person is responsible for assisting with research, administration, data entry and management of contracts and system records, focused on but not limited to 3rd party Dark Fiber contracts, orders and supporting documents.  As part of the Off Net Solutions (ONS) Team, the role requires interaction with 3rd party telecommunications providers as well as with internal Crown Castle team members and attorneys, in person, by phone, video, and email. 


Suitable candidates will have an interest in learning the commercial, contractual aspects of the procurement and activation of optical fiber-based telecommunications services from 3rd parties, and in applying this knowledge to conduct research for incomplete or missing information.  This person will have an aptitude for reading technical service contracts, extracting material terms and conditions, learning, and using a variety of online records systems, performing accurate data entry and correction resulting from the ongoing research efforts, summarizing original deal points, pertinent interdependencies of associated addendums, amendments, and SOWs for future negotiations, additions, renewals, or replacements as appropriate.  While Off Net Solutions (ONS) leadership will be always available for training, guidance and overall support, the ideal candidate will be comfortable working independently.


Responsibilities



  • Review existing records for missing or expired data

  • Obtain missing contracts, data, and associated documents – internal and external

  • Extract key contract/agreement terms and summarize in templates and/or systems

  • Enter Data into multiple systems to correct missing and/or incomplete records

  • Run reports and help prioritize work with ONS management

  • Follow standards and procedures when working within company systems

  • Execute quality checks on the data to ensure asset integrity and resolve data conflicts to maintain compliance

  • Perform other duties as assigned or required


Expectations 



  • Read telecommunications service contracts and extract key terms

  • Demonstrate the aptitude to comprehend the basic technical aspects of fiber optic communications systems, and how these are represented in associated legal contracts

  • Perform accurate and fast data entry based on extracting key details of technical contracts.  

  • Work independently as well as build cooperative working relationships

  • Excel at chasing down elusive documents and details

  • Preserve and respect confidentiality of data and contractual terms

  • Work competently and accurately with various online computer systems and demonstrate proficiency using Microsoft Office (Outlook, PowerPoint, Excel, Word, Visio).

  • Be proficient managing network files and folders (naming, renaming, moving, copying, archiving, etc.)


Education/Certifications  



  • Currently enrolled in pursuit of a Bachelor’s degree from an accredited higher education institution

  • Preferred field(s) of study: Computer Science; Information Technology; Law (or Pre-Law); Engineering (all disciplines)


 


Experience/Minimum Requirements  



  • Authorization to work in the U.S. on a full-time, regular basis without additional sponsorship




Reports to: Manager, Carrier Relations
